Like plastic and other forms of waste, cigarette butt are supposed to find their way into waste management systems. But you and I know that some waste escape the approved waste management system ending up in the natural environment. Cigarette butt is no exception.
Cigarette butt forms a considerable part of waste polluting the natural environment. Cigarette butt contains substances that are toxins and therefore dangerous to the natural environment. Cigarette butts are not biodegradable. Cigarette butts make the environment (especially beaches) dirty. Toxins from cigarette butt leaches into seas and sand. Fish in the seas eat cigarette butt thinking it is food. The toxin in the cigarette butt is released into the fish.
A little cigarette butt here, a little cigarette butt there add up to a whole lot of cigarette butts, each little butt releasing toxins amounting to, on aggregate, a large amount of toxin which upsets the balance of  the natural environment.
